Best Ways⁣ to Experience Venice on ‌a Budget

Exploring the​ enchanting ​canals and rich culture of Venice doesn’t have to empty your wallet.​ You can ⁣experience this magical city⁢ without​ breaking the⁢ bank by⁤ focusing on a few key activities and strategies. First, consider taking a walking tour. Venice is best appreciated on foot, allowing you⁤ to ⁢discover hidden gems in charming alleyways and picturesque squares. ⁤Look for free⁣ or donation-based walking tours‌ that highlight the⁣ city’s history and ‌culture. Additionally, indulge ⁤in⁣ local cuisine⁤ by ⁤seeking⁤ out bacari, ‍small bars⁢ known⁣ for their affordable cicchetti (tasty Venetian tapas) paired with a‍ glass​ of​ wine.For an unforgettable view without ‍the steep⁢ entry‍ fees, head to Piazza San Marco either early⁣ in the morning or during sunset when the crowds are thinner and the ⁣ambiance is magical. Using public transport is⁣ another savvy choice; the vaporetto ⁣ (water bus) can cover more‌ ground at a fraction of the price of​ a gondola‌ ride. ​To help ​you plan​ a budget-friendly itinerary, here’s a‍ simple table showcasing essential places and costs:

ActivityEstimated Cost
Walking TourFree – €15
Bacari⁣ Meal (cicchetti & Wine)€10⁣ – €20
Public Transport ‍(Vaporetto Day Pass)€20
Piazza ‌san MarcoFree

Another budget-friendly tip is ‍to explore some of the lesser-known islands in the lagoon, like‌ Burano and Murano, where‍ you ‌can enjoy beautiful sights and crafts‍ without the typical tourist marks. Engaging with locals and⁢ embracing a slower pace allows you to enjoy Venice’s⁣ charm without spending excessively. Tips for Making the Most of Your Money While ⁣Visiting Venice

To truly savor the magic of Venice without breaking the⁢ bank, consider employing a few savvy strategies that can stretch your euros further. First and foremost, embrace‌ local cuisine by dining⁣ away from tourist ‌hotspots; explore charming backstreet trattorias ​where authentic pasta dishes⁤ and cicchetti⁤ are served at a fraction of the price.Utilize the public transportation​ options, like the ⁣Vaporetto, which ⁤not only grants ‍you access to stunning views ⁢of the Grand Canal but‍ is ⁤much ⁤more⁣ economical than⁤ private water taxis. ‌With an eye on ​your budget, opt for⁣ walking tours combined with free or⁣ low-cost attractions; many of ‍Venice’s most breathtaking‍ sites—such⁣ as St. Mark’s square and the Rialto Bridge—are ⁤best ⁢appreciated on foot, and wandering the lesser-known ⁢alleyways often reveals ‌hidden gems. When it comes to ⁣shopping, consider purchasing handmade souvenirs directly from artisans rather than at ‍mainstream stores,​ as this supports⁣ local craftsmen⁢ and ​usually results in ⁣more unique finds.remember to visit during the off-season (late autumn or ​early spring), when accommodation rates drop significantly and crowds are less intimidating, making‍ your Venetian experience ⁣even more enjoyable and‍ affordable.
